Chris Sherwood 68e1bd5ff2 feat(KB): ratio registry for disk + time estimates (Phase 1B of RFC #883)
Foundation for the cost estimates and partial-stall detection that
Phase 2 will surface. No consumers yet — this PR just lays the table,
the seed rows, and the lookup helper so subsequent UI work has
estimates available without a per-ZIM benchmark.

## What lands

- New table `kb_ratio_registry` (pattern, chunks_per_mb, sample_count,
  notes). Migration creates and seeds heuristic defaults from the RFC
  appendix: devdocs (1100/MB), Wikipedia variants (270/MB), iFixit
  (50/MB), Stack Exchange Q&A (200/MB), video-only ZIMs (0), plus a
  catch-all fallback at 100/MB.
- `KbRatioRegistry` model with static `lookup()` and `estimateChunks()`.
- Pure helper `kb_ratio_lookup.ts` doing longest-prefix-match — a
  specific entry (`wikipedia_en_simple_`) overrides a broader one
  (`wikipedia_en_`). 9 unit tests covering the lookup boundary.
- `sample_count` starts at 0 (heuristic seed) and is reserved for
  Phase 4 self-calibration to increment as observed ZIMs update each row.
